The authors investigate the global dynamics of a degenerate linear differential system with symmetry with respect to the origin, expressed in the following normal form: \[ \begin{cases} \dot x=\alpha_1x+\beta_1y+\gamma_1\textrm{sgn}(x+1)+\gamma_1\textrm{sgn}(x-1), \\ \dot y=\alpha_2x+\beta_2y+\gamma_2\textrm{sgn}(x+1)+\gamma_2\textrm{sgn}(x-1), \end{cases} \] where \[ \alpha_1\beta2 = \alpha2\beta1, \alpha_1^2 + \alpha_2^2 + \beta_1^2 + \beta_2^2 > 0, \gamma_1^2 + γ_2^2 > 0, \] endowed with two paralleled switching lines given by \[ \Sigma^- := \{(x, y) \in\mathbb{R}^2\,:\, x = -1\},\quad\Sigma^+:=\{(x, y)\in\mathbb{R}^2\,:\, x = 1\}. \] After analyzing the qualitative properties of all equilibria including infinity and the number of closed orbits, they obtain all global phase portraits on the Poincaré disc. From these main results, they find necessary and sufficient conditions for the existence of crossing limit cycles, crossing heteroclinic loops and sliding heteroclinic loops, respectively, and prove that the numbers of these three types of closed orbits are all at most 1. Moreover, switching lines maybe pseudo singular lines or boundary singular lines.
